Biography of Mozart

One of the most widely appreciated prominent musical maestro ever happened to live in the history, musical genius Mozart was born on 27 January 1756 in Salzburg, Austria to Leopold Mozart, a business-minded composer, violinist and an assistant concertmaster at the Salzburg court and Anna Maria Pertl. He was named Johannes Chrysostomus Wolfgangus Gottlieb Mozart in honor of his grandfather (maternal) and a Saint Johannes Chrysostomus with whom he shared his birth date.

Being born and brought up in a family where music was in air, in life and in dreams of everyone, Mozart was naturally attracted towards music. From his childhood, Wolffanfus learned and developed immense interest in music. When he was just 5 years old, Mozart started composing small and beautiful melodious numbers. Looking at his children's musical talent, Mozart's father decided to use this opportunity to showcase the talent of his children (Wolfgangus and elder daughter Maria Anna "Nannerl") in front of the world. At the age of six (in mid 1763), Mozart and his elder sister performed in many concerts in European Courts (In Paris and London); they also gave performances at major cities where they met many music lovers. They also performed in front of the Bavarian elector, royal families and the Austrian empress. Wolfgangus and his sister played piano and violin and were more than successful to tie their audiences to the chairs.

Soon, Wolfgangus wrote and published his first composition and when he was nine years old he started writing symphonies. Demand for his music show started increasing so much that only nine months after coming back from his tour in 1766, the Mozart family again set for yet another tour of Vienna. However, due to some problems Mozart could not perform in an opera in Vienna.

After coming from the tour of Vienna, Wolfgangus tried to concentrate on improving and learning new skills in music, for this reason he did not plan any tour till 1770. In next three years from 1770 to 1773, Mozart toured Italy three times and gave many outstanding performances. While on tour of Italy, Mozart even wrote two of his famous operas 'Mitridate' and 'Lucio Silla'. Mozart showcased his talent and astonished his audience when he adopted Italian style in his music. Mozart further started his journey of music composition, he wrote set of string quartet and also some symphonies. When Mozart was at Salzburg during the period from 1774 to 1777, he worked as Konzertmeister (Concert Master) at the Prince Archbishop's Court where he performed in some Piano and Violin concerts (about half a dozen piano sonatas), masses, symphonies etc. During the same period, he visited Munich once in 1775 for a premier of his Opera La Finta giardiniera.

Wolfgangus was very ambitious and wanted to attain a very high position in the world of music, he knew that staying in Salzburg it was never possible to achieve what he wanted; in 1777 Mozart left Salzburg with his mother and set for Munich and Mannheim. There he tried his best to find a good post for himself but was never offered one, he then moved to Paris in search of the same. In Paris, Anna Maria (Wolfgangus's mother) died and Wolfgangus became very lonely, here also Wolfgangus could not get any suitable post for himself. After Wolfgangus's all the unsuccessful trials, Leopold called him back to Salzburg, where he managed to arrange a high level post for his son. For next two years, Wolfgangus, worked at Court and played concerts at Courts and Cathedrals. He actively participated in concerts, serenades and also composed music for dramas. He also continued composing and creating symphonies. In 1780 he received the most awaited opportunity to perform in an opera at Munich. 

Along with many concerts, operas and music composition for dramas, Mozart also wrote beautiful music compositions, which have become masterpiece of his artwork. Mozart was sent to the court at Vienna where he was not allowed to work for the post he wanted the most, he finally gave up trying to perform at the court in Vienna and got out of the job around 1781. After that period, Mozart received many golden opportunities to make fortune when he created music while he was not at any post. Soon, Mozart started going in public, he played music in public functions, published his work and also started teaching music. Further in 1787, Mozart was offered a minor court post as Kammermusicus, where he wrote dance music for court balls. In year 1782, Mozart married Constanze Weber (younger sister of Aloysia Weber, Mozart’s former lover).

Mozart gained a reasonable popularity by publishing some beautiful sonatas (for violin and piano), music compositions, and by performing in concerts and Operas like 'Die Entfuhrun aus dem Serail' (in 1782, which was one of his most successful operas with many songs in it. NOTE: Mozart wrote serious as well as comic operas (he wrote three comic operas in his life)), he also wrote some quartets, which he had dedicated to his Haydn who appreciated Mozart for his knowledge of music and composition talent. Mozart also gained popularity by managing concerts on his own, without any assistance he not only composed music for the concert but he also managed the orchestra. Mozart earned enough to live a comfortable life, but because of his improper management of money and expenses, he was never able to save money for future and always had to borrow from others when was in need of money.

Mozart spent rest of his life in Vienna; during this period he also visited various places such as Salzburg, Berlin etc. to perform in operas, dramas and concerts. Mozart died on 5 December 1791 in Vienna. (There are different stories regarding the death of musical genius, according to one story he died of the feverish illness (Rheumatic Fever) and according to another he died of poisoning). 

 
Mozart composed hundreds of beautiful and unique music works which include over 20 operas, about 14-15 Masses, 30-40 concerts (piano and violin), 50-60 symphonies, and 20 sonatas etc. Even after his death, Mozart remained and will remain one of the most favorite musicians for millions of his fans

Shakira Biography



COLOMBIAN TALENT
Shakira was born in Barranquilla, Colombia on February 2, 1977, his mother Spanish Catalan descent and his father of Lebanese descent. At eight he began writing and composing songs, one of the first songs I wrote called Your Dark Glasses, which talks about his troubles and his father who died in a car accident. First participated in the game show Child Artist Looking for 1988, transmitting the regional chain of the Colombian coast Telecaribe, Shakira won the contest for three consecutive years.
At ten years old, Shakira auditioned for the school choir but was rejected because her voice was considered "too strong." His friends told him he sounded like a goat. Shakira started looking for other singing competitions, and a television transmitting weekly contest, llamabaVivan Children program.
Between ten and thirteen Shakira was invited to various events in Barranquilla, and became a local celebrity. At that time, he met the theater producer Monica Ariza, helped her to become known outside Barranquilla.
During a flight from Barranquilla to the capital Bogotá, Ariza was sitting next to a Sony Colombia executive Ciro Vargas. Vargas was impressed and got an audition for Shakira, which came a few weeks later to the hotel lobby. Sony Ciro Vargas returned to office and gave Shakira tape with some of the songs she had written, but failed to please producers of everything, and thought Shakira was "hopeless."
Vargas was convinced that she had talent, and set up a surprise audition in Bogotá. He cheats Sony Colombia executives inviting them to go to a bar, and around midnight, announced that he had a surprise: Shakira. She sang three songs, and his performance was a success. Shakira was contracted to record three albums.

Shakira moved to Bogota, and with only thirteen years old, he released his debut album in 1991 entitled Magic, recorded and released through Sony Colombia. The songs were written by her when she was eight, however, the album was a commercial disappointment, selling less than one thousand copies.

Danger became his second album, released in 1993, when Shakira was only fifteen.
This album had sales results just disappointing that his previous album, after bad "taste" queShakira took with their first two albums, chose better to take a while to finish high school.

 
1995-2000: Success in the Hispanic market
Shakira then leaned toward the interpretation and acted in a Colombian telenovela called El Oasis with moderate success. After the failure with their first two albums, Shakira returned to music in 1995 with her third studio album in Spanish that would make a great figure at Latin America, the unpublished material is titled album Pies Descalzos. The first single I am here led to fame in the Spanish music, album sales increased. The songs Pies Descalzos, Sueños Blancos and Where you heart? became pop culture icons Hispanic.

shakira the remixesshakira pies descalzos escuchar gratis bajar canciones fotos videos With ales of over four million copies later made remixes of Pies Descalzos in her first remix album titled simply The Remixes which generated sales of over one million copies in Latin America, the album also included Portuguese versions of some of their best-known songs.
In March 2000, began his tour of Latin America and the United States, Panama starting and ending in Argentina, which lasted only three months called Amphibious Tour. In August 2000, won an MTV Video Music Award in the former category of International Audience Award with the song "Ojos Así.

 
2001-2004: Invading the English market
In 2001, thanks to the success of the album Where Are the Thieves?, Shakira began work on what would become their debut album in English. In collaboration with Gloria Estefan, Shakira wrote and recorded English versions of "Where are the Thieves?, And new songs which were also created for the album Laundry Service. The release of the unpublished material recording opened the doors to the English market and around the world, with influences of rock and Spanish and Latin influences, the album also featured four Spanish songs including Stay With You. Some critics claimed that Shakira's experience with the English language was very little for her and for writing as well as its pronunciation and little consistency in the lyrics of their songs (it was satirized in a MAD TV skit), but Laundry Service was a commercial success, selling over thirteen million worldwide, helped him become known as a singer. Especially its first single Whenever, Wherever he held various positions number one in several countries and was six in the U.S. in the Billboard Hot 100, also launched a Spanish version was equally successful with the title of luck.
In 2002, Shakira also released an album called simply Greatest Hits recompilatorio, an album that combines the best of singer of his albums Pies Descalzos, Where Are the Thieves?, MTV Unppluged and Laundry Service. But also launched in 2004, a DVD with a compilation of ten songs called Live & Off the Record, with sales reaching two million worldwide, Shakira made a tour to promote a Laundry Service called Tour of the Mongoose. The tour name was derived from the fact that mongoose can defeat a cobra without being killed by the effect of their venom. The concerts were encouraged to fight a mongoose with a cobra.
In September 2002, Shakira was one of the last artists to win an MTV Video Music Award in the now defunct International Audience Award category with the theme Luck. In October of that year, won five MTV Latin Awards in the categories of Best Female Artist, Best Pop Artist, Best Artist North, Video of the Year (for Suerte) and Artist of the Year. At that time he met Antonio de la Rua, son of former president of Argentina Fernando de la Rua, who until now continues to maintain a relationship.

Oral Fixation Volume 1
Oral Fixation Volume 1 was released during the month of June in Europe, North America, Australia and Latin America. Shakira said in his own words that "it is the most eclectic album of his career." The album reached the top of sales in Mexico, Colombia, Argentina, Spain and several Latin American countries. Within the U.S. Oral Fixation Vol 1 debuted at number four in the Billboard 200, something unusual for a Spanish album. To date (2006) the album has sold just over decinco million copies worldwide.
The first single from their fifth studio album in Spanish entitled La Torturacon the contribution of the Spanish singer Alejandro Sanz. The song, with influences of reggaeton and Latin pop, led him to occupy the first places in the charts in Mexico, Spain, Colombia, Argentina, Chile, Venezuela, United States (on the Hot Latin Tacks for twenty-five weeks) , among other countries. Both songs enjoyed moderate success in the Spanish-speaking countries compared to La Tortura.
On August 28, 2005, Shakira became the first Latin artist to interpret a song in Spanish during the ceremony of the MTV Video Music Awards, held in Miami, Florida. With the collaboration of singer Alejandro Sanz performed the first single from the album Fijacion Oral Vol 1: La Tortura. On 28 February, the album material was given his second Latin Grammy in the category of Best Latin Rock Album.

 
Oral Fixation Vol 2
During the month of November 2005, he released his second studio album in English entitled Oral Fixation Vol 2, which is defined as the continuation deFijación Oral Vol 1, debuted at number five in the United States in the Billboard 200.  fijacion oral shakira discografia fotos gratis videos
On April 3, 2006, Shakira received an honorable mention in a ceremony of the Organization of the United Nations, the creation of the foundation called Pies Descalzos, which is responsible for assisting and protecting children who suffer domestic violence in Colombia In the event she said: "Do not forget that at the end of day when everyone goes home, 960 children have died in Latin America." On 27 April this year, Shakira won six Latin Billboard awards, making the title of creditors biggest winner of the night.

Recently it was announced that a statue of Shakira in a corridor of her hometown of Barranquilla, Colombia, donated by an artist of German origin.
Hips Do not Lie, is a song with a mix of Caribbean rhythms, Latin pop, reggaeton and hip hop with rapper and producer Wyclef Jean. The single has become the most successful song in Shakira's English, beating Whenever, Wherever Laundry Service album. With the launch of Hips Do not Lie as a bonus track on the album, increased sales of Oral Fixation Vol 2 around the world, but especially in the United States jumped from position number 98 to number six on Billboard 200, which led to being awarded the certification of disk platinoel April 4, 2006 to have more than one million copies sold in the U.S.
The music video simulates a traditional holiday in his hometown Barranquilla, Colombia, with sensual hip movements and simple choreography managed to become his second video to reach number one on MTV's TRL (in America known as The 10 + orders), the first being Objection (Tango) from the album Laundry Service.
Spain is now touring with her Oral Fixation World Tour, and will soon visit the United States, Romania ... also going to play the single Hips Do not Lie in a modified version called "Bamboo version 'at the closing ceremony of World Cup Germany 2006.
